Autogenous and Semi-Autogenous Mills. Autogenous (AG) and Semi-Autogenous (SAG) milling has seen increased use in recent years, especially in large mineral processing operations. These mills typically have a large diameter relative to their length, typically in the ratio or 2 or 2.5 to 1. AG mills employ ore as the grinding media.
Gold ore processing Cyanide process. Cyanide extraction of gold may be used in areas where fine gold-bearing rocks are found. Sodium cyanide solution is mixed with finely ground rock that has been proven to contain gold or silver and is then separated as a gold cyanide or silver cyanide solution from ground rock.

The gold cyanidation process is a primary method of gold beneficiation. Activated carbon is a critical component in the beneficiation of gold ore, allowing this widespread process to occur because of its ability to recover gold from the gold-cyanide complex. Depending on the deposit, some silver ores may also be processed via cyanidation.

mineral processing, art of treating crude ores and mineral products in order to separate the valuable minerals from the waste rock, or gangue. It is the first process that most ores undergo after mining in order to provide a more concentrated material for the procedures of extractive metallurgy.The primary operations are comminution and concentration, but there are other …
grade copper ore may be only one quarter of one percent. The gold content of a good grade gold ore may be only a few one-hundredths of a percent. The processing of gold ores has traditionally made use of conventional crushing and grinding circuits. In each case where gold is formed either as coarse native particles or in coarse grained sulphides, it is recovered by gravimetry concentration in the in the comminution circuit in addition to recovery of finer values by leaching.

You can remove the most common metals found in gold ore (copper, zinc and lead) using elements that bond with oxygen at lower temperatures than gold. This oxidation process will make copper oxide, zinc oxide and lead oxide — all of which are less dense than pure gold and will float to the top of your crucible allowing the slag to be sloughed off.

Kaolinite Processing Mining Mineral Processing . Aug 23, 2019· The kaolinite dry mining process is a simple and economical process. The ore is crushed to 25.4mm by a hammer crusher and fed into the cage mill to reduce the particle size to 6.35mm. The hot air in the cage mill reduces the moisture of the kaolin from about 20% to 10%.
